Theatre: Grade 6

CreatingTH:Cr

  •  1

    Generate and conceptualize artistic ideas and work.TH:Cr1

    1. 1

      Envision/ConceptualizeTH:Cr1.1

      1. a

        Identify possible solutions to blocking challenges in a theatrical work.TH:Cr1.1.6.a

      2. b

        Identify solutions to design challenges, as they relate to supporting the characters and story in a theatrical work.TH:Cr1.1.6.b

      3. c

        Explore a scripted or improvised character by imagining the given circumstances in a theatrical work.TH:Cr1.1.6.c

  • 2

    Organize and develop artistic ideas and work.TH:Cr2

    1. 1

      DevelopTH:Cr2.1

      1. a

        Use critical analysis to improve, refine, and evolve original ideas and artistic choices in a devised or scripted theatrical work. TH:Cr2.1.6.a

      2. b

        Contribute ideas and accept and incorporate the ideas of others in preparing or devising a theatrical work.TH:Cr2.1.6.b

  •  3 

    Refine and complete artistic work.TH:Cr3

    1. 1

      RehearseTH:Cr3.1

      1. a

        Articulate and examine choices to refine a devised or scripted theatrical work. TH:Cr3.1.6.a

      2. b

        Identify effective physical and vocal traits of characters in an improvised or scripted theatrical work.TH:Cr3.1.6.b

      3. c

        Explore a planned technical design during the rehearsal process for a devised or scripted theatrical work. TH:Cr3.1.6.c

PerformingTH:Pr

  •  4

    Select, analyze, and interpret artistic work for presentation.TH:Pr4

    1. 1

      SelectTH:Pr4.1

      1. a

        Identify the essential events in a story or script that make up the dramatic structure in a theatrical work.TH:Pr4.1.6.a

      2. b

        Experiment with various physical choices to communicate character in a theatrical work. TH:Pr4.1.6.b

  •  5 

    Develop and refine artistic techniques and work for presentation.TH:Pr5

    1. 1

      PrepareTH:Pr5.1

      1. a

        Recognize how acting exercises and techniques can be applied to a theatrical work. TH:Pr5.1.6.a

      2. b

        Articulate how technical elements are integrated into a theatrical work.TH:Pr5.1.6.b

  •  6

    Convey meaning through the presentation of artistic work.TH:Pr6

    1. 1

      Share/PresentTH:Pr6.1

      1. a

        Adapt a theatrical work and present it informally for an audience. TH:Pr6.1.6.a

RespondingTH:Re

  •  7

    Perceive and analyze artistic work.TH:Re7

    1. 1

      ReflectTH:Re7.1

      1. a

        Describe and record personal reactions to artistic choices in a theatrical work. TH:Re7.1.6.a

  •  8

    Interpret intent and meaning in artistic work.TH:Re8

    1. 1

      InterpretTH:Re8.1

      1. a

        Research and explain how artists make choices based on personal experience in a theatrical work.TH:Re8.1.6.a

      2. b

        Identify cultural perspectives that may influence the evaluation of a theatrical work. TH:Re8.1.6.b

      3. c

        Identify personal aesthetics, preferences, and beliefs through participation in or observation of a theatrical work.TH:Re8.1.6.c

  •  9 

    Apply criteria to evaluate artistic work.TH:Re9

    1. 1

      EvaluateTH:Re9.1

      1. a

        Use supporting evidence and criteria to evaluate drama/theatrical work.TH:Re9.1.6.a

      2. b

        Apply the production elements used in a theatrical work to assess the production’s aesthetic choices.TH:Re9.1.6.b

      3. c

        Identify a specific audience or purpose for a theatrical work.TH:Re9.1.6.c

ConnectingTH:Cn

  •  10

    Synthesize and relate knowledge and personal experiences to make art.TH:Cn10

    1. 1

      EmpathizeTH:Cn10.1

      1. a

        Explain how the actions and motivations of characters in a theatre work impact perspectives of a community or culture.TH:Cn10.1.6.a

  • 11

    Relate artistic ideas and works with societal, cultural, and historical context to deepen understanding.TH:Cn11

    1. 1

      InterrelateTH:Cn11.1

      1. a

        Identify universal themes or common social issues and express them through a theatrical work.TH:Cn11.1.6.a

  •  12

    Relate artistic ideas and works with societal, cultural, and historical context to deepen understanding.TH:Cn12

    1. 1

      ResearchTH:Cn12.1

      1. a

        Research and analyze two different versions of the same theatre story to determine differences and similarities in the visual and aural world of each story. TH:Cn12.1.6.a

      2. b

        Investigate the time period and place of a theatre work to better understand performance and design choices.TH:Cn12.1.6.b
